2025 Governors Awards

The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ences announced today that its Board of Governors voted to present Academy Honorary Awards to Debbie Allen, Tom Cruise and Wynn Thomas, and the Jean Hersholt Humanitarian Award to Dolly Parton. The four Oscar® statuettes will be presented at the Academy’s 16th Governors Awards event on Sunday, November 16, 2025, at the Ray Dolby Ballroom at Ovation Hollywood.

The Board of Governors of the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ences announced today the creation of an annual competitive Academy Award® for Achievement in Stunt Design, beginning with the 100th Academy Awards® for films released in 2027.

he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ences announced today the creation of the Janet Yang Endowment to Celebrate and Preserve Asian and AAPI filmmaking as part of Academy100, a global revenue diversification and outreach campaign designed to expand the Academy’s worldwide scope, ensure the success of its next 100 years, and connect audiences through their shared love of cinema. This endowment will, in perpetuity, celebrate the legacy, impact, and contributions of Asian and AAPI filmmakers and provide essential funding and resources to support Asian and AAPI programming at the Academy Museum, as well as the acquisition and preservation of Asian and AAPI-related film items in the Academy Collection. The endowment honors the legacy of Yang, the first Asian American president of the Academy, whose dedication to advancing diversity has helped pave the way for greater representation in entertainment and beyond.

The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ences’ Nicholl Fellowships in Screenwriting, an international program that identifies and nurtures talented new screenwriters, will now exclusively partner with global university programs, screenwriting labs and filmmaker programs to select Nicholl fellows. Each partner will vet and submit scripts for consideration for an Academy Nicholl Fellowship, and The Black List will serve as a portal for public submissions. All scripts submitted by partners will be read and reviewed by Academy members.
